2026年金融科技监管趋严背景下,反欺诈模型误报率每降低1%可节省千万级运营成本(某银行实测数据),但传统特征工程面临特征混杂性难题。因果发现算法通过识别欺诈行为的真实诱因,为测试人员提供可解释的优化路径。
一、误报率高企的三大测试痛点
特征混杂干扰
规则引擎中非因果关联特征(如“夜间交易频率”)被过度加权,导致正常用户行为误判,某支付平台因此产生23%误拦截数据漂移失效
传统监控滞后性使模型在节日流量峰值时误报率飙升300%,需人工紧急降级规则对抗样本盲区
GAN生成的欺诈样本穿透率达15%,暴露模型鲁棒性缺陷
二、因果发现算法的测试实施框架
工具链配置
# 因果图构建示例(Python + DoWhy库) from dowhy import CausalModel model = CausalModel( data=df_transaction, treatment='transaction_amount', outcome='fraud_flag', graph="digraph { user_age->transaction_amount; ip_region->fraud_flag }" ) # 识别混杂因子 identified_estimand = model.identify_effect()△ 关键步骤:
混杂因子检测:通过PC算法自动识别非因果边(如“用户地域→欺诈概率”的伪关联)
反事实验证:注入合成数据测试“若取消某特征,误报是否消失”
动态权重调整:依据因果强度系数重构特征权重矩阵
测试用例设计矩阵
测试类型 | 输入数据 | 预期效果 |
|---|---|---|
混杂因子消除 | 去除“设备型号”特征 | 误报率↓18% (A/B测试结果) |
干预响应测试 | 强制修改交易时间戳 | 因果特征敏感度提升40% |
鲁棒性压力测试 | 注入10%对抗样本 | 误报波动率<5% |
三、头部金融机构落地收益
某信用卡中心实施因果测试方案后:
误报率从12.7%→3.1%(降低76%)
模型迭代周期从14天缩短至3天
关键因果特征数量减少65%,提升规则可维护性
(数据来源:2026年Q1金融风控测试白皮书)
四、测试人员能力升级清单
数据素养:掌握因果图构建工具(DoWhy/LiNGAM)
场景设计:构建动态漂移测试环境(参考AWS TDaaS方案)
效能度量:建立因果效应指标(ATE/CATE)监控看板
2026趋势预警
欧盟《数字金融法案》要求反欺诈模型需提供因果可解释性报告,未达标企业将面临年营收4%罚款。测试团队需在Q3前完成因果验证能力建设。
精选文章:
突破测试瓶颈:AI驱动的高仿真数据生成实践指南
包裹分拣系统OCR识别测试:方法论与实践案例
建筑-防水:渗漏检测软件精度测试报告